WebSep 20, 2024 · This converts the correlation coefficient with values between -1 and 1 to a score between 0 and 1. High positive correlation (i.e., very similar) results in a dissimilarity near 0 and high negative correlation (i.e., very dissimilar) results in a dissimilarity near 1.
